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
958 3908126011 529493
0873 7612101512 58101028
0873 7612101512 58101028
1502 398142696 8223525 79 35
All about undefined
Interested in learning more?
0873 7612101512 58101028
1502 398142696 8223525 79 35
See more
747 0147763000
47 6871 2970 361940405 93
See more
277 95636613344
96764957628 0955695 026417202
See more